New
look
The new Navigation Pane provides easy-to-use
navigation to all parts of Music Label 2004. The Music-page
holds all information about your music, data files and artists. The
Playlists-page is where you create and maintain your playlists.
When you want to create a new person (to loan items to) or want to reutrn items
from a person, the Loan Manager is the destination. The
Wanted Items section keeps track of all the items you plan to
buy and the Statistics section is where you head when you want
some statistics.
Integrated Artist Database
Music
Label 2004 features a new integrated Artist Database where you can collect
information about your favourite artists and groups. This will enable you to get
artist reports with bio and discography.
Vinyl
Query
You can now search an online database (Amazon) to retrieve
basic information about your vinyl records (or CDs) by simply typing artist
and/or title.
User Defined Views
It is now possible
to create your own Views with fields, filter and sorting. This means you can
create an unlimited number of Views for any purpose. Example: Create a view
called "Favourites from '95" that shows just that.
New
Statistics
The Statistics has pretty much looked the same since
1997, so we decided to change this. You can now choose different types of
statistics and how to view them.
Fully Customizable Menu and
Toolbar
In Music Label 2004, you can customize the menu and toolbar
to look the way you want them to. You can drag and drop items between the menu
and toolbar and even within the menu.
